EOTech’s EXPS3 HD holographic sight debuts with an all-aluminum housing, rotary dial controls, and shake awake in a duty-grade HWS package. That combination sets the EXPS3 HD apart from previous EXPS models while keeping the same core footprint and performance. EOTech positions it as a direct evolution of the EXPS3 rather than a replacement. The company plans to start shipping the optic in Q2 2026 with an MSRP of $999. On the SHOT Show floor, Streamlight debuted the ProTac Rail Mount VIR Pro, a multi-fuel weapon light designed for long guns that combines white light and infrared output in a single housing. The unit supports both rechargeable SL-B26 batteries and CR123A cells, giving users flexibility depending on mission or logistics. A Dual-Spectrum Streamlight VIR Weapon Light for Long Guns The VIR Pro delivers three white-light output levels. High mode produces 1,100 lumens, medium outputs 450 lumens, and low drops to 120 lumens. Candela ratings scale accordingly, with 40,000 candela on high, 19,000 on medium, and 4,200 on low. Springfield Armory is moving quickly to support the Aimpoint COA optic, adding factory A‑Plate slide cuts across several pistol lines starting in March. What’s Changing Beginning in March, Springfield will have all Echelon pistols, along with the 1911 Operator, 1911 Emissary, and Prodigy, available with factory slide cuts designed for the Aimpoint COA. Buyers will also be able to order these pistols pre‑mounted with the optic. Springfield says purchasing the gun with the optic installed can save up to $150 compared to buying the components separately. Jungfrau-Aletsch-Bietschhorn The Jungfrau-Aletsch-Bietschhorn region is a magnificent area with high mountain ranges, glaciers and is actually the most glaciated part of the European Alps. Visiting this area can be done relatively easy by car and if you want to go up, by train up to 3,400 metres above sea level, the highest train ride in Europe, the Jungfrau Railway is very impressive (and expensive!). The area is on the UNESCO World Heritage list because of its unique and wide range of flora and fauna and geological importance regarding the creating of the High Alps.
